Travis Scott Jordan 1 Low Reverse Olive Medium Olive Release

Travis Scott and Jordan 1's latest collaboration arrives on September 28, 2024, featuring bold olive tones and signature details

The highly anticipated Travis Scott x Air Jordan 1 Low OG Medium Olive is the latest collaboration between the iconic rapper and Jordan line. Known for his creative flair and unique sneaker designs, Travis Scott continues to push boundaries with each new release. The “Medium Olive” edition brings a fresh, fall-ready look, showcasing the perfect blend of earthy tones and signature details that have come to define Scott’s partnership with Nike.

Let’s explore the unique design, performance, and the ongoing success of Travis Scott’s collaborations with Air Jordan.

Unique Design and Signature Elements

The Travis Scott Reverse Olive Medium Olive sneaker combines olive suede with Sail leather overlays, creating a clean yet bold contrast that enhances the shoe’s overall look. One of the defining features is the black reverse Swoosh on the lateral side, a design hallmark that has become synonymous with Travis Scott’s collaborations with Air Jordan. Meanwhile, a regular black Swoosh adorns the medial side, balancing the shoe’s boldness with classic elements.

Red accents appear on the tongue’s Nike Air logo and on the mismatched Cactus Jack and Jordan Wings logos on the heel, adding a sharp pop of color. Additionally, co-branded insoles emphasize the collaboration, and extra laces in black and pink allow wearers to customize their look.

Performance and Comfort

As with previous Travis Scott x Jordan collaborations, the Reverse Olive Jordan 1s excel in both style and performance. The foam midsole ensures comfort for daily wear, while the olive rubber outsole provides traction and durability. These sneakers aren’t just for show – they’re designed to be functional and long-lasting, making them suitable for everyday use.

The pre-aged midsole adds a vintage feel to the shoe without compromising on modern comfort, combining classic aesthetics with contemporary sneaker technology.

Look Back: Travis Scott and Air Jordan Collaborations

Travis Scott’s partnership with Jordan line has redefined sneaker culture since its inception in 2017. The first major release, the Air Jordan 4 “Cactus Jack”, showcased Scott’s creative approach, featuring vibrant colors and unique branding elements. However, it was the Air Jordan 1 High OG “Mocha” in 2018 that truly set the standard for his collaborations. The reverse Swoosh, which debuted on the Mocha, became a defining feature of his work with Jordan line.

Over the years, Scott has worked on multiple Air Jordan models, including the Air Jordan 6 and Air Jordan 4, but the Air Jordan 1 has remained the most iconic. Releases like the Fragment x Travis Scott Jordan 1 and the Reverse Mocha have only fueled the hype around Scott’s collaboration with Jordan line, making each new drop a highly anticipated event. The Medium Olive Jordan 1s continue this trend, offering another iconic addition to the collection.

Why the Medium Olive Stands Out

The Travis Scott x Air Jordan 1 Low OG “Medium Olive” is perfectly timed for the fall season. The combination of olive green suede and Sail leather offers a neutral yet eye-catching palette that fits easily into any wardrobe. The olive outsole and vintage midsole tie the whole look together, making this release a stylish yet practical option for the cooler months.

Release Date and Pricing

The Travis Scott x Air Jordan 1 Low OG “Medium Olive” will be released on September 28, 2024, through select Jordan Brand retailers and Nike’s SNKRS app. Priced at $150 for adult sizes, the collection also includes sizes for kids and toddlers, making this a full-family release. As with all of Scott’s previous collaborations, the sneakers are expected to sell out quickly, so fans will need to act fast.
